TYCO "Dream Builders" Super Blocks Building Set, 1992
Girls can build, too -- even though most early construction toys had been targeted to boys. In the early 1990s, Tyco decided to tap this previously overlooked market and produced "Dream Builders" sets. With these pastel-colored bricks, girls could create teen bedrooms, kitchens, shopping malls, playgrounds and other play sets -- or create a world of their own.

Trade Card for Dr. Jayne's Patent Medicines, "The Talking Well," 1880-1900
In the last third of the nineteenth century, an unprecedented variety of consumer goods and services flooded the American market. Advertisers, armed with new methods of color printing, bombarded potential customers with trade cards. Americans enjoyed and often saved the vibrant little advertisements found in product packages or distributed by local merchants. Many survive as historical records of commercialism in the United States.
